With Father's Day approaching, here is a story, in the Hobbyists Series, of a Coast Guard father and son continuing a family tradition: fathers and sons in a workshop sanding, sawing and carving memories with woodworking.
Hobbyists is a video series on the activities and hobbies of the U.S. service members outside of work. This video, Chip off the Ol' Block, is of Coast Guard Senior Chief Petty Officer Rob Adams and his son Alex, who spend their time together between deployments doing woodworking projects together.
Rob used to do wood projects with his father and is now passing on the generational tradition of woodworking to his son.
